FLYHT Aerospace Solutions Ltd V.FLY

Alternate Symbol(s):  FLYLF

FLYHT Aerospace Solutions Ltd. provides solutions for the aviation industry. The Company's aircraft certified hardware products include Automated Flight Information Reporting System (AFIRS), AFIRS Edge, Tropospheric Airborne Meteorological Data Reporting (TAMDAR) and FLYHT-WVSS-II. AFIRS is an aircraft satcom/interface device, which enables cockpit voice communications, real-time aircraft state analysis, and the transmission of aircraft data while inflight. The AFIRS Edge is a 5G wireless quick access recorder (WQAR), aircraft interface device (AID), and aircraft condition and monitoring system (ACMS). TAMDAR system is a sensor device installed on aircraft that captures temperature, atmospheric pressure, winds aloft, icing, turbulence, and relative humidity. FLYHT-WVSS-II is an externally mounted aircraft sensor that detects and reports water vapor as relative humidity. The Company's wholly owned subsidiary, CrossConsense, offers skilled services to the commercial aviation industry.

AeroMechanical Spring 2011 Fact Sheet

AeroMechanical Spring 2011 Fact SheetJust got an email from AMA announcing the availablity of a new company  fact sheet on their website .Check it out . Nice summary of  where they are currently. I found the Customer flight & hours chart of  AFIRS usage  most interesting as it shows quite a rising trend of usage over the last 3 years. As  pointed out during thier webcast ,  Flights & usage  are a more relevant performance indicator than just the sale of the hardware alone  .To be  fair the bottom line financial  revenue  chart shows AMA  taking  quite  a hit this year due to AFIRS  228 with  R&D cost of 4.5 mil  but it also begs the question when the R&D is complete  what is the ongoing R&D cost going to be. As it lowers  which IMO  it should next year  the prospects of improving revenues along with the availability of AFIRS 228 in the marketplace in Q4  bodes well for SP outlook. This could explain the sudden insider buying .
